Amid the Federal Trade Commission's antitrust trial against Meta, tensions between Silicon Valley and journalists surfaced. Meta's lead attorney, Mark Hansen, disparaged tech journalist Om Malik as a 'failed blogger' to undermine the credibility of expert witness Scott Hemphill. He also suggested that Kara Swisher, a well-known journalist, held biases against Meta. The trial spotlighted unresolved tensions, as Hansen tried to discredit the case against Meta by questioning the motivations of journalists involved in the antitrust discussion.
